The Nuragic Sanctuary of Santa Vittoria is situated on a basaltic plateau near Serri and is one of Sardinia's most visited prehistoric sites. It offers a fascinating insight into Nuragic civilization and its architectural prowess. At its core lies an impressive Nuragic temple and a well sanctuary, dedicated to the cult of water.

The extensive archaeological complex spans approximately 670 meters above sea level and was frequented for centuries. Visitors can explore the remains of ancient buildings, including a well sanctuary with a covered atrium, an access staircase, and a hypogeum structure with a tholos vault. Numerous burials attest to the site's significance. The presence of a later Byzantine church named Santa Vittoria gave the site its current name.

Das Nuragische Heiligtum von Santa Vittoria in Serri ist einer der wichtigsten Kultkomplexe des nuragischen Sardiniens und erstreckt sich über mehr als drei Hektar. Das Herzstück des Heiligtums ist der Brunnenstempel, der dem Wasserkult gewidmet ist und aus massiven Blöcken gebaut wurde. Dort versammelten sich die nuragischen Völker. Die archäologische Stätte umfasst den heiligen Brunnen und weitere Strukturen.
